Ancient Roman CivilizationPorta Praenestina

in Ancient Roman Civilization

Porta Prenestina, today known as Porta Maggiore, is one of the eastern gates in the ancient but well-preserved 3rd century Aurelian Walls of Rome. It is the most lavish gate among the original roman ones.

Ancient AqueductsPorta Praenestina (Aquae Claudia and Anio Novus)

in Ancient Aqueducts

The original gate was built centuries before the Aurelian wall (in which it is now embedded) in 52 by the emperor Claudius, and is formed by arches through two aqueducts, the Aqua Claudia and the Anio Novus.

Ancient Roman CivilizationPorta Asinaria

in Ancient Roman Civilization

The Porta Asinaria, the Gate of the Donkeys, was built as a minor gate in the Aurelian Wall. It achieved notoriety when in AD 546 traitors opened this gate to let Totila and his Goths slip into the city.

Ancient AqueductsPorta Tiburtina (Aquae Iulia, Marcia, and Tepula)

in Ancient Aqueducts

Although the Tiburtina gate is set into the Aurelian walls, it was not built with the walls, as it belonged to an older pre-existing aqueduct by emperor Augustus (5 BC): this is stated by an inscription above the gate.

Ancient Roman CivilizationPorta Tiburtina

in Ancient Roman Civilization

Also known today as Porta S.Lorenzo, this is a gate in the eastern course of the Aurelian wall. The road which once passed through it was via Tiburtina, named after ancient town it ran to, Tibur (now Tivoli) about 30 Km.- 20 miles east of Rome.

Ancient Roman CivilizationAqueduct of Nero, Via Domenico Fontana - Rome, Italy

in Ancient Roman Civilization

Nero's Aqueduct, subsequently named Celimontano's Aqueduct was built by Emperor Nero, as a branch of the Aqua Claudia Aqueduct, in order to bring water to the Domus Aurea, the artificial lake and the nymphaeum of the temple of the divine Claudius.
